30分鐘掌握R語言編程基礎

以下是一些掌握R語言編程基礎需要知道的內容:

  • 語法和數(shù)據(jù)類型
    R語言是一種類型的語言,支持多種數(shù)據(jù)類型,例如整數(shù)、浮點數(shù)、字符串和數(shù)組等。
    R語言中的數(shù)據(jù)類型通常使用字符串來表示。例如,整數(shù)類型可以使用"integer"字符串來表示。
    R語言中的變量名可以使用字符串、變量名和數(shù)字來表示。例如,x可以使用"x"字符串或者"data$x"來表示。
  • 訪問數(shù)據(jù)和操作數(shù)據(jù)
    R語言中的數(shù)據(jù)可以通過訪問器(accessor)來操作。例如,可以使用"length"訪問器來獲取一個數(shù)組的長度。
    R語言中的數(shù)據(jù)可以使用"["和"]"來訪問。例如,要訪問數(shù)組的第一個元素,可以使用"data[1]"。
    R語言中的數(shù)據(jù)可以使用訪問器函數(shù)來操作。例如,可以使用"sum"函數(shù)來計算一個數(shù)組的和。
  • 控制流程和循環(huán)
    R語言中的控制流程使用"if"語句和"for"循環(huán)來實現(xiàn)。例如,可以使用"if(x > 0)"來檢查數(shù)據(jù)的條件。
    R語言中的循環(huán)可以使用"for"和"while"循環(huán)來實現(xiàn)。例如,可以使用"for(i in 1:length(data))"來迭代數(shù)組。
  • 數(shù)據(jù)處理和變量操作
    R語言中的數(shù)據(jù)數(shù)據(jù)的不同方式進行處理,例如排序、分組、聚合等。
    R語言中的變量可以使用"assign"函數(shù)來更改變量的值。例如,可以使用"x <- 10"來更改變量x的值為10。
    R語言中的變量可以使用"mutate"函數(shù)來更改變量的值,也可以使用" assignment "來更改變量的值。例如,可以使用"x <- 10"或者x <- 10"來更改變量x的值為10。
    R語言中的變量可以使用"<<-"函數(shù)來更改變量的值。例如,可以使用"x <<- 10"來更改變量x的值為10。
    R語言中的變量可以使用 "" 來獲取變量的值。例如,可以使用"print(x)value"來打印變量x的值。
  • 函數(shù)和模塊
    R語言中的函數(shù)可以使用"function"來定義。例如,可以使用"add=function(x,y) x+y"來定義一個函數(shù)add,該函數(shù)接受兩個參數(shù)x和y,返回它們的和。
    R語言中的模塊可以使用"source"來導入。例如,可以使用"source('module.rs')"來導入一個名為module的模塊。

這些內容是掌握R語言編程基礎需要知道的內容,通過學習和實踐,您可以更深入地了解R語言,并開始編寫自己的R程序。

?著作權歸作者所有,轉載或內容合作請聯(lián)系作者
【社區(qū)內容提示】社區(qū)部分內容疑似由AI輔助生成,瀏覽時請結合常識與多方信息審慎甄別。
平臺聲明:文章內容(如有圖片或視頻亦包括在內)由作者上傳并發(fā)布,文章內容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務。

相關閱讀更多精彩內容

友情鏈接更多精彩內容